Output ec3bca5d825c03a21b4d1f3a851807898a9e4959afa1308fa3fef34daead41af:1

value
1499038
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7c15d9b088a3e4c702bbc025cffc357a13f94a72 OP_EQUALVERIFY OP_CHECKSIG
address
1CK6xybw7V12RSVP25MsWxmG2DZcKLvpP4
transaction
ec3bca5d825c03a21b4d1f3a851807898a9e4959afa1308fa3fef34daead41af
confirmations
268042
spent
true